If Capcom revealed the cast of Resident Evil 5, the whole gaming world would probably know about it. Sadly, the company is still keeping that info under wraps. IMDB however, hosts a list of some stars from different backgrounds - all of them under Biohazard 5's belt.
It is noted that "Because this project is categorized as being in production, the data is subject to change; some data could be removed completely," but the selection of characters alone make quite an interesting revelation. Dead guys Osmund Saddler (RE 4) and Steve Burnside (RE: Code Veronica) are apparently making a comeback. Ada supposedly died in RE 2 but came back alive and kicking to help Leon in RE 4, but it's pretty hard to imagine how Saddler and Steve could've survived their death scenes. Assuming that the list is real, either they both appear in flashbacks or we're up for a radical spin on Resident Evil's story. It's also difficult to miss that Chris Redfield isn't around, considering that the first trailer unveiled made everyone believe Chris will be the main character. Yoko Suzuki and Rita from Outbreak also made the cut; will they be the next RE stars?Here's the list - feel free to make your own speculations.
